We are a small, close-knit college
of approximately 1000 students. However, we are also part of a
larger university community that includes 18,000 students, excellent
library facilities, state-of-the-art computer labs, a well-stocked
bookstore, plentiful student services, and great places to eat.
The faculty and staff are well qualified and friendly, they care
about our students.
We provide a quality education and students "learn-by-doing,"
in the classroom as well as in our many field laboratories.
Cal Poly Pomona is an excellent value for the educational dollar.
It's one of the lowest priced universities in California and is
nationally recognized by U. S. News and World Report as one of
the best regional universities in the west.
Students actually get to know each other--a real feat at larger
universities. They study, work and play together.
There are many exciting opportunities for students to become involved
with extra-curricular activities through competitive teams, clubs
and other student organizations.
We're located in a major metropolitan area, which means more jobs,
housing, internships, scholarships and entertainment opportunities
for our students. But in spite of this, our campus still retains
a rural atmosphere dominated by croplands, orchards, pastures
and livestock.
Our faculty members are actively involved with industry research
and provide practical research opportunities for our students.
Our academic programs have developed several "centers of
excellence" to enhance the classroom learning experience
and provide expertise to industry.
